The Keck School of Medicine (KSOM) of the University of Southern California (USC) and Children’s Hospital Los Angeles (CHLA) in the Department of Pediatrics in the Division of Pediatric Nephrology, are actively seeking a full time faculty member (1,0 FTE) for the position of Clinical Assistant Professor of Pediatrics (Clinician Educator).
Requirements for the positions include a medical license in California and certification or active candidate status in the Sub-Board of Pediatric Nephrology.
The Nephrology Division serves a 370-bed tertiary care children’s hospital with all surgical and medical disciplines active. We are seeking to expand the number of faculty to meet our increasing clinical needs. The Division cares for an average of 55-60 chronic dialysis patients (hemodialysis and peritoneal dialysis), 120 post-transplant patients, 100 patients identified with chronic renal insufficiency and is a major referral center (over 1000 new patient per year), in the greater Los Angeles area. Twenty-five to thirty renal transplants are done each year. The candidate will participate in resident, medical student, fellow teaching and ongoing clinical research projects. Basic and clinical research opportunities are available within the Division and Hospital (to qualified candidates). Up to 25% protected time for clinical or basic research can be negotiated for individuals interested in a clinical investigator career.
